Choosing the Right Wordpress Design Agency

Assessing Your Budget

When selecting a Wordpress design agency in Belgium, budget considerations are key. Agencies here offer competitive rates, but the cost can vary depending on the project's complexity and the agency's prominence. Here are a few budgeting tips for different business sizes:

Small Businesses and Startups

For these, engaging with medium-sized agencies or specialized consultants can be cost-effective. They generally provide high value for smaller budgets, with basic Wordpress design packages starting from around €2,000 to €7,000.

Medium-Sized Enterprises

These businesses might need more comprehensive services, such as custom plugin development or e-commerce integration. Working with experienced agencies might cost between €7,000 and €20,000, depending on the depth of the work required.

Large Enterprises

Big companies often require extensive, bespoke Wordpress solutions which can involve multiple sites or high-level security features. Prices for these complex projects usually start at €20,000, reaching much higher depending on the specifications.

Integrating e-commerce functionality into WordPress design without compromising aesthetics is crucial for Belgian businesses looking to create visually appealing and high-performing online stores. Here are some key strategies to achieve this balance:

  1. Choose a responsive e-commerce theme: Select a WordPress theme that's specifically designed for e-commerce and optimized for Belgian market preferences. Look for themes that offer a clean, modern design and are fully responsive to ensure a seamless shopping experience across all devices.
  2. Utilize WooCommerce: As the most popular e-commerce plugin for WordPress, WooCommerce offers extensive customization options. It integrates seamlessly with many WordPress themes and allows for aesthetic enhancements without sacrificing functionality.
  3. Implement custom CSS: Use custom CSS to fine-tune the design elements of your e-commerce site. This allows you to maintain brand consistency and create a unique look while working within the constraints of your chosen theme and plugins.
  4. Optimize product presentation: Use high-quality product images and consider implementing features like image zoom, 360-degree views, and product videos. These elements enhance the visual appeal of your site while providing valuable information to potential customers.
  5. Streamline the checkout process: Design a clean, minimalist checkout page that reduces distractions and focuses on completing the sale. Include trust signals like secure payment icons and incorporate Belgian-specific payment methods such as Bancontact.
  6. Incorporate white space: Utilize white space (or negative space) in your design to create a sense of elegance and make your products stand out. This approach is particularly effective for luxury or high-end brands in the Belgian market.
  7. Use a consistent color scheme: Choose a color palette that aligns with your brand and apply it consistently throughout your e-commerce site. This creates a cohesive look and enhances the overall aesthetic appeal.
  8. Implement AJAX functionality: Use AJAX to load content dynamically, reducing page reloads and creating a smoother, more app-like user experience without sacrificing design elements.
  9. Optimize for speed: Ensure your e-commerce site loads quickly by optimizing images, minifying CSS and JavaScript, and leveraging caching. A fast-loading site not only improves user experience but also contributes to a perception of professionalism and quality.
  10. Incorporate local design elements: Consider incorporating subtle design elements that resonate with Belgian customers, such as icons or imagery that reflect local culture or landmarks. This can enhance the aesthetic appeal while creating a stronger connection with your target audience.

By implementing these strategies, Belgian businesses can create WordPress e-commerce sites that are both visually stunning and highly functional. Remember, the key is to strike a balance between aesthetic appeal and user-friendly functionality, always keeping the preferences and expectations of the Belgian market in mind.

Creating visually appealing and user-friendly WordPress designs in Belgium requires a careful balance of aesthetics and functionality. Here are the key elements that Belgian WordPress designers and agencies focus on:

  1. Clean and Responsive Layout: With mobile internet usage in Belgium reaching 79.8% in 2023, responsive design is crucial. Layouts should adapt seamlessly to various screen sizes, ensuring a consistent experience across devices.
  2. Intuitive Navigation: Belgian users appreciate efficient website navigation. Implement clear menu structures, logical page hierarchies, and easy-to-use search functionality to enhance user experience.
  3. Belgian-Centric Color Schemes: While maintaining brand identity, consider incorporating colors that resonate with Belgian culture. For example, using black, yellow, and red subtly can create a connection with the Belgian flag without being overly patriotic.
  4. Typography: Choose fonts that are both aesthetically pleasing and legible. Consider using web-safe fonts or properly implemented custom fonts that support both Dutch and French characters, as Belgium is a multilingual country.
  5. High-Quality, Relevant Imagery: Use professional, high-resolution images that reflect Belgian culture, landscapes, or business environments when appropriate. This helps create a more relatable experience for local users.
  6. Fast Loading Times: Belgium boasts an average internet speed of 95.90 Mbps as of 2023. Optimize images, leverage caching, and minimize HTTP requests to ensure your WordPress site loads quickly to meet these high-speed expectations.
  7. Accessibility Features: Adhere to WCAG guidelines to make your WordPress site accessible to all users, including those with disabilities. This is not only ethical but also aligns with EU digital accessibility directives.
  8. Localization: Implement multilingual support using plugins like WPML or Polylang to cater to both Dutch and French-speaking populations in Belgium. Consider region-specific content and date/time formats.
  9. Clear Call-to-Actions (CTAs): Design prominent and compelling CTAs that guide users towards desired actions, whether it's making a purchase, signing up for a newsletter, or contacting the business.
  10. White Space Utilization: Employ ample white space (or negative space) to create a clean, uncluttered design that allows content to breathe and improves readability.
